David M. Wenrich, 82, Landisville, passed away in the morning of Oct. 18, 2008, in Lancaster Regional Medical Center, following a five-week illness.
Born in Robesonia, he was a son of the late Clayton Michael and Elsie M. (Putt) Wenrich. He was the husband of the late Ruth M. Wenrich, who passed away in May 2001.
David had moved to Lancaster in 1966 from Virginia.
He served with the United States Navy for 21 years, until he retired in 1970 as a chief petty officer.
He also served the East Petersburg Borough as a police officer for five years, then worked for United Refinery and also with Red Rose Interiors until he retired in 1991.
He was a member of Veterans of Foreign Wars Post 5956 in Manheim.
He will be remembered lovingly by his children: Charles R. 'Bud,' husband of Bonnie Bonte, Elizabethtown; David M. Jr., husband of Cara M. Wenrich, Hellam; Joseph E., husband of Connie M. DiNino, Reading; Dean R., husband of Roxanne Wenrich, Lititz; and Bonnie M. Simons, Wilmington, N.C.; 15 grandchildren, 11 great-grandchildren and a sister, Joan Noll, Myerstown.
A brother, William Wenrich, and a sister, LaRue Roth, preceded him in death.
